Prerequisite to update with Salesforce

Glossary

  • SalesForce Objects and Fields

Salesforce uses Objects and Fields to store data. Standard Objects like Task, Lead, Opportunity are built into Salesforce whereas Custom Objects are created by your company.

Fields help describe an Object... the who, what, when, where, how. Standard Objects have Standard Fields but can also have Custom Fields that are created by your company.

When creating an Incenteev dataset you will select an Object and then work with its Fields to create the exact metric/ indicator you want. Incenteev automatically reads all Fields related to an object.

  • Incenteev Dataset and Indicators

A dataset describes the structure of the data based on which indicators on Incenteev are created. This structure description is necessary so that Incenteev can read all the data provided via files/CRM integration/manually (Read more about dataset). Indicators are based on dataset and translate performance into quantitative metrics.

Update dataset based on Salesforce

  • Create dataset based on SalesForce Object

Datasets can be created when a dashboard or challenge is configured inside the space and/or they can be created directly at the organizational level at Organization Administration > Manage shared datasets.

SalesForce Object Dataset:

In "Organization Administration > Manage shared datasets" click on "Create a shared dataset” and choose “Select a Salesforce Object” Option.

Select the Object based on which you would like to import data and name your dataset. By default, Incenteev gives it the name of the SalesForce Object.
The “ Result Owner” section establishes if individuals OR teams get credit for the data. Usually, we will assume that individuals own the data results.
The “User field name” section indicates the field that describes the result owner for the respective SalesForce Object. Usually, this will be prefilled with the Salesforce Owner ID field. Click “Save” to create the dataset!

Once created, all fields of the SalesForce Object will be automatically read by the dataset. Each update of data on SalesForce will also be reflected in real-time on Incenteev.

You can now create indicators!

🧐 NB :

  • If you have 2 datasets based on the same SalesForce Object, one with “users” as result owners and the other one with “teams” as result owners, we consider them different and hence we recommend distinct names.

  • You can not delete a SalesForce object dataset if an indicator is already using this dataset. You must first delete the indicator/s.

  • If you decide to “STOP UPDATES” you can not restart them again.
